MrC J. Collishaw, RAC Training Organisor, explains the controls on the Vespa scooter

MrC J. Collishaw, RAC Training Organisor, explains the controls on the Vespa scooter presented today by the Douglas Sale and Service Ltd. to the Cardiff Eagle Club, to be used by the
RAC and Auto Cycle Union for their joint training scheme for learner motor cyclists.
He is explaining the controls to Mr O.J. Kingsman (Cardiff Road Safety Officer), Supt. Andrews of the
Mobile Division, Mr W. Thomas (Chief Constable) and PC C.T.
Pennington of the mobile division* (seated on the cycle).
28th July 1955

Western Mail Archive
Mirrorpix
